code challenge problem

I am having trouble with this code challenge on Sass.

"We want to add a style to our previous Sass code declaring that on hover, all direct <a> children have an opacity of 0.5. Use the ampersand selector to achieve this, rather than repeating the > a direct child selector."

You need to nest the ampersand hover pseudo selector inside of your "> a" selector:

/* Write your SCSS code below. */
p {
  a {
    color: red;  
  }
  > a {
    color: blue;
    &:hover {
      opacity: 0.5;
    }
  }
}
